  • Hello everyone, welcome to another kiln opening. I'm starting to use more Mayco glazes because they yield great results and are cheaper in price. There is some trial and error of course but that is to be expected. Muddy Waters and Himalayan Salt were new for this kiln opening. Himalayan Salt produced a pinkish overtone on a cream colored background. I will use it for the bottom part of the cups with flowing glaze on top. Muddy Waters turned a matte brown. Tigers Eye was one of my favorites from the last kiln opening. I used it a lot this time because it goes great when combined with AMACO Obsidian or Oatmeal glaze.
